Introduction to Micro-SD Cards
Micro-SD cards are a type of removable flash memory card used to increase the storage capacity of devices such as smartphones, tablets, and cameras. They are designed to be compact, with the “micro” prefix indicating their small size, making them ideal for use in portable devices where space is limited. The primary function of a micro-SD card is to provide additional storage for files such as photos, videos, music, and applications, thereby expanding the device’s internal memory.
How Micro-SD Cards Work
Micro-SD cards work by storing data in a non-volatile manner, meaning that the data remains on the card even when it is not powered. This is achieved through flash memory technology, which allows for efficient and reliable data storage. When a micro-SD card is inserted into a compatible device, the device can read and write data to the card, effectively using it as an extension of its internal storage. Micro-SD cards come in various capacities, ranging from a few gigabytes to several terabytes, offering users a range of options to suit their storage needs.

Introduction to SIM Cards
SIM (Subscriber Identity Module) cards, on the other hand, are small smart cards used in mobile phones and other mobile devices to authenticate and identify subscribers on a cellular network. They are issued by mobile network operators and contain a unique serial number, known as the International Mobile Subscriber Identity (IMSI), which is used to identify the subscriber. The primary function of a SIM card is to connect the device to the mobile network, enabling services such as voice calls, text messaging, and internet access.
How SIM Cards Work
SIM cards work by storing data and instructions that the mobile device uses to communicate with the cellular network. When a SIM card is inserted into a device, it provides the device with the necessary information to register on the network, allowing the user to make and receive calls, send texts, and access data services. SIM cards also store contacts and text messages, although this functionality is increasingly being moved to the device itself or cloud services.
Types of SIM Cards
Over the years, SIM cards have evolved in size and technology. The most common types include:
- Full-size SIM cards, which were the original size but are now largely obsolete.
- Mini-SIM cards, which were smaller and widely used until the introduction of even smaller versions.
- Micro-SIM cards, which are smaller still and were used in many smartphones before the advent of the nano-SIM.
- Nano-SIM cards, which are the smallest and are currently the standard for most modern smartphones.
- eSIM (embedded SIM), a newer technology that allows for remote provisioning of SIM data, eliminating the need for a physical SIM card in some devices.
Key Differences Between Micro-SD Cards and SIM Cards
While both micro-SD cards and SIM cards are small and play critical roles in mobile devices, they are fundamentally different in terms of their purpose, functionality, and the benefits they offer to users. The key differences can be summarized as follows:
- Purpose: Micro-SD cards are used for expanding storage capacity, while SIM cards are used for connecting to and authenticating on cellular networks.
- Functionality: Micro-SD cards store files, applications, and data, whereas SIM cards store subscriber identity information and enable network services.
- Interchangeability: Micro-SD cards can be easily removed and inserted into different devices that support them, without affecting the device’s ability to connect to a network. SIM cards, however, are specific to the mobile network operator and the device may need to be unlocked to use a SIM card from a different operator.

How do I choose the right micro-SD card for my device?
Choosing the right micro-SD card for your device depends on several factors, including the device’s compatibility, storage capacity needs, and speed requirements. First, you need to check your device’s manual or manufacturer’s website to see what type of micro-SD card it supports. Some devices may only support certain types of micro-SD cards, such as micro-SDHC or micro-SDXC. You should also consider the storage capacity you need, taking into account the types of files you will be storing and the amount of space you need.
In addition to compatibility and storage capacity, you should also consider the speed of the micro-SD card. If you plan to use the card for applications that require high-speed data transfer, such as video recording or gaming, you will need a card with a high speed rating. Look for cards with a high Class rating, such as Class 10 or U3, which indicate the card’s minimum write speed. You should also consider the brand and quality of the micro-SD card, as well as the price and warranty offered by the manufacturer.
Can I use a SIM card from one carrier with another carrier’s network?
It depends on the type of SIM card and the carriers involved. If you have a locked SIM card, it is tied to a specific carrier and may not work with another carrier’s network. However, if you have an unlocked SIM card, you may be able to use it with another carrier’s network, provided that the carrier supports the same frequency bands and technologies as your SIM card. You should check with the carrier to see if they support your SIM card and what requirements they have for using it on their network.
In some cases, you may need to obtain a new SIM card from the new carrier or have your existing SIM card unlocked or reprogrammed to work with the new carrier’s network. Additionally, some carriers may have specific requirements or restrictions for using a SIM card from another carrier, such as requiring a specific plan or service agreement. It’s always best to check with the carriers involved to determine the best course of action and to ensure that you can use your SIM card with the desired network.
